Mallett set for SuperSport return
After an extended period off air, SuperSport analyst and former Springbok coach Nick Mallett will make his studio return for this weekend’s Super Rugby.
Mallett confirmed the news to Netwerk24 on Tuesday.
His return will mark his first appearance on air since mid May, when the Ashwin Willemse incident took place. The incident involved Willemse accusing fellow analysts Mallett and Naas Botha of “patronising” and “undermining” him, also referring to them as players from the apartheid era, followed by a walk off air on live TV.
SuperSport’s investigation subsequently found no racism from either Mallett or Botha.
Willies refused to engage with SuperSport in their investigation and remained silent on the matter, speaking publicly for the first time on Tuesday.
Naas Botha made his SuperSport return last weekend.
